Hi, my baby knocked her forehead on the rounded edge of her cot when going from sitting to standing. She hit it right in the middle of her forehead about 4 weeks ago, and there was a big bruise which has gone down. The bump itself has stayed a little bit, and under that is a thin hard lump which is dark reddish through the skin - ie: there is obviously some dried blood underneath it. We are heading to the doctors on Monday but I just wondered if anyone's baby has had the same? Worried.

GP here - it is probably a subperiosteal haematoma - sounds awful but is just a bruise that is trapped beneath the membrane over the bone - really common with injuries to parts with little tissue covering - forehead & shin, mostly.

It will leave a lump for a-g-e-s which will gradually resolve over the next few months - months, really. It might leave a small lump which doesn't resolve, or even a small dent.
